Angiopoietin-2 (ANGPT2) is a member of the Ang family, a family of angiogenic factors that play major roles in angiogenesis during the development and growth of human cancers, but also during lymphangiogenesis.
ANGPT2 is generally considered an antagonist of ANGPT1 and endothelial TEK tyrosine kinase (TIE-2, TEK).
ANGPT2 disrupts the vascular remodeling ability of ANGPT1 and is thought to induce endothelial cell apoptosis, resulting in vessel regression.
Expression of ANGPT2 has been linked to invasive and metastatic phenotypes of gliomas and other cancers.
